Output 7058fc8828de91ef1fd6d4de00ef4a82d53d3078c2428a58eccc3a3c27d74c0a:0

value
2905230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ce2ef50d5636ab3c256e8bc5cf75f617681d00f OP_EQUAL
address
34Kkhd6n8dbftHDk3Vv9oVd66tV9TFPXhD
transaction
7058fc8828de91ef1fd6d4de00ef4a82d53d3078c2428a58eccc3a3c27d74c0a